While I love the acrylic print option as I commented earlier, I've learned that the acrylic print option is more susceptible to fine surface scratches. I've decided the very shiny prints on metal are maybe even more dramatic and less prone to surface scratching than the prints under acrylic.

I just ordered prints of some of my wine pieces here and just love the acrylic prints sandwiched in between the 1/4 inch clear acrylic and black backer board. You'd swear the prints were under glass. The clarity is unbelievable and the thickness of the glass-like acrylic gives the pieces a real substantial presence. The black backer board lends a fine black visual border. The acrylic print option is the way to go for a very sleek, contemporary look. If I order any prints to keep for myself or for gifts, I will choose the acrylic print option over any of the other options, including gallery wrapped canvas prints. I just love the novel, contemporary look it adds!

Artist's Description

When I spied these cannas with the sunlight penetrating through the veins in their leaves revealing such brilliant, unbelievable colors, I knew I had to paint them. I crouched down low to the ground to catch the light streaming through them on camera. Then I was off and running to paint them. Of course, I pushed the colors beyond reality. It seemed as though the wind had arranged them to sway as if they were reveling in response to the adoring audience's cry of 'Encore'! Here's to repeat performances!

About Sandi Whetzel

Sandi Whetzel

Sandi developed a "do-it-yourself" attitude during her teens when she couldn't afford luxuries. She fabricated her wardrobe and then her home decor after she married. Mesmerized by PBS TV art demo shows, Sandi painted some of her hand-fashioned garments. When the couple purchased new furniture, wall art was not in their budget. Recalling the PBS art shows and her fabric painting, Sandi passionately plunged into oil painting, learning by trial and error. Sandi's self-guided art experiments blossomed with four years of instruction from a talented community college art instructor, Bonnie Hill, of Roseburg, OR.
